职位描述
岗位职责:
1、项目需求分析与整理,负责软件项目的整体规划,把控项目进度,确保项目按计划交付。
2、负责架构设计、功能规划、流程设计等。
3、负责MES软件开发,包括前/后端以及数据库编程、部署、实施等等。
4、负责软件单元测试和集成测试,负责系统日常维护和故障排查,确保系统的稳定运行。
5、撰写相关的技术文档,包括设计文档、接口文档、部署文档、使用手册等。
任职要求:
1、本科及以上学历,软件工程、计算机科学、自动化、信息技术等相关专业。
2、3年以上MES软件开发工作经验,熟悉MES的原理、架构与功能,有成功主导离散或流程制造行业MES项目开发经验者优先。
3、熟练掌握至少一种C++、JAVA、C#、python等主流编程语言,能独立完成应用程序开发,熟悉面向对象设计和编程,熟悉多线程编程,有良好的编程习惯规范。
4、熟练使用至少一种ORACLE、MySQL、PostgreSQL、TDengine、达梦等数据库管理系统,熟练掌握SQL语句及存储过程等编程和优化技巧。
5、熟悉基本通讯接口与协议,如:TCP/IP、串口、USB、Modbus、MQTT等;
6、具备良好的系统架构设计能力,能够根据业务需求设计合理的系统架构,确保系统的可扩展性和可维护性。
7、具备良好的理解能力与沟通能力,有团队合作精神,有较强分析问题和解决问题的能力。
以担保或任何理由索取财物,扣押证照,均涉嫌违法,请提高警惕